About The Position

Applied Industrial Technologies is seeking an experienced Business Intelligence / Analytics professional to join our company as Sr Manager, Analytics & Reports to lead the development and implementation of a robust BI environment that satisfies the ever-growing information needs of the business. In this role, you will focus on the development and operation of the Business Analytics, including managing staffing requirements, and optimizing processes, technology and performance. You will work closely with business executives and stakeholders in other departments in order to identify, recommend, develop, implement and support analytics solutions to deliver essential information to satisfy their information needs.
